Mid-Year Makeup Examinations

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

The following is the schedule of the mid-year make-up examinations released yesterday by University Hall. All the examinations listed below will be held in Harvard 6 and will begin at 2 o'clock. They will last three hours. A fee of $3.00 for each make-up examination which the student has been authorized to take will be included in the student's term bill. This fee will be charged whether or not the student takes the examination, and remitted only if he notifies the Assistant Dean in charge of Records, 3 University Hall, in writing, at least three weeks before the date of an examination that he does not expect to take.

The following rules are also in force: "No student is permitted to take any books or papers into the examination room except by express direction of the instructor. No communication is permitted between students in the examination room on any subject whatever." "A student who is not in the examination room within five minutes after the hour appointed for the examination shall not be admitted without permission of the instructor or of the officer in general charge of the examinations."
